This FAQ indirectly explains the design that a well designed high-end preamp + DAC is just as good as a bypass switch:
https://nuprimeaudio.com/ufaqs/what-kind-of-volume-control-and-preamp-do-you-use-for-your-dac/
You could set the volume of CDP-9 at your desire level and then use the remote control to turn it off. The volume level will be memorized and you just leave it alone.
